Aligning with Indigenous Self-Determination: Strategies for Nation-Led Partnerships and Workforce Engagement
About this event
As Indigenous communities across Canada continue to assert their autonomy in governance, education, health, and economic development, self-determination is no longer a future ideal — it is a present reality reshaping how employers, governments, and organizations must engage. This session explores the meaning and momentum behind Indigenous self-determination, and what it demands of organizations looking to build authentic, effective, and respectful relationships. We’ll examine how workforce strategies, partnership models, and community engagement approaches must evolve to align with Nation-led priorities and structures — and how to avoid common missteps that undermine trust and long-term collaboration.
